DAY TWO
So my trip to New York was mainly for college visits so my first visit was to Hofstra University in Hempstead, NY. As you can see from the pictures, the campus is gorgeous, but I'm pretty sure any campus on the east coast during autumn is gorgeous because of the trees! I have never seen so many yellow and orange and red leaves—my heart was in heaven. The one thing about Hofstra that I loved was when the couple that found Hofstra were planning to build the university, the only way the wife would be okay with it was if her cats would be able to roam around the campus freely so now the descendants of those cats walk around and live on campus, which is pretty cool coming from a cat lover hehe

DAY FOUR
My final day in New York was spent at Fordham University, located in the Bronx. Let me say this, I LOVE THIS CAMPUS SO MUCH omg the Gothic architecture of the buildings combined with the gorgeous trees (and not to mention the gorgeous boys hehe) I have officially fallen in love with this school! Also after the campus tour, we ate at this amazing Italian restaurant on Arthur Ave. which is known as the Little Italy of the Bronx so that was a plus hehe I definitely could see myself at this school in the near future!
